Ticket: Staging env misconfigured for Siftgate bloom filter

The bloom layer in front of the Pellet KV store is rejecting all lookups in staging because the env file was copied from the dev template without credentials. False-positive tuning values are fine; only the auth line is missing. To unblock the weekly demo, the Pellet admission secret must be set on the following line.

env line for yaguf-fajop: LEDGER_TOKEN13=fb08984397349

# PixelForge CLI — batch image resizing tool (Marrowvale Labs)
# This env file configures the resize worker pool and the upload step
# that pushes processed assets to our Cloudburst bucket. All values here
# are environment-scoped; nothing is baked into the binary. Rotation
# policy: the upload credential below must be rotated every 90 days and
# is scoped to write-only access on the assets prefix. The next line
# sets the credential used for uploads.

env line for kaweg-hawip: LEDGER_TOKEN13=119f0d8c76b81

- [ ] **Step 7: Breaker override escrow.** After sealing the signing keys for the Tallgrove upstream API circuit breaker, confirm the support team can force the breaker open during a full outage. The override bundle lives in the sealed escrow drawer and is useless without its unlock phrase. Two ceremony witnesses must initial this step before proceeding. The escrow bundle is decrypted with the recovery passphrase that follows.

vault phrase of kahip-kahop = holath-quenmir

Subject: Handover — Timetabler release

Nadim,

Taking over Timetabler releases from me as of tonight. Current state: v3.2 of the school timetable solver is in staging. Known issue: the constraint engine occasionally deadlocks on schools with split-shift schedules — restart the solver pod, it recovers. Release window is Thursday 02:00. Rollback is one command, documented in the runbook. Publishing to the artifact registry requires signing the release bundle; nothing ships unsigned. The signing key you'll need is here.

rollout seal: bky9_PeXH1fTLY